greatgooglymoogly 02-16-2014 04:48 PM

Nebraska has a string of winnable games before they host Wisconsin, which finishes their regular season. The good news is that a bunch of their losses aren't bad (UMass, @ Creighton, @ Cincy, @ Iowa, @ Ohio State, and the two to Michigan) - Nebraska had a tough, tough schedule this year. The bad news is that the Huskers don't have many good wins - before today, their strongest victory was at home over Ohio State, with a steep drop off below that, so Nebraska doesn't have many chances to add quality wins.

The Purdue game will be very interesting. As of now, Nebraska should have a better chance of making the tournament because Purdue's best win is a pain in the rear end to find (Minnesota? West Virginia?), but they already have a victory over the Huskers, and they have several chances to pick up Top 25 wins before the B1G Tournament.
